POST-DOCTORAL RESEARCH
 
Nov 2001 – Sep 2006 Department of Biochemistry, University of Cambridge
Cambridge
, England - Structure elucidation of protein-protein complexes, understanding helical assemblies
CURRENT RESEARCH AREAS
 
Macromolecular crystallography, Structural approach to understanding pathogenic proteins, with emphasis on kinetoplastida
